Oregon – As the most common pine species in North America, Ponderosa pine trees are easy to spot in the wild: their orange-colored bark makes them stand out from the crowd. But one particular tree in the Rogue River-Siskiyou National Forest in Oregon really stands out. The pine tree, nicknamed “phalanx,” is the world’s tallest pine tree, standing at a height of over 268 feet. That’s about as high as a 30-story building! The phalanx tree is in good company, surrounded by other Ponderosa pines that are over 250 feet tall. Walk beneath their vast canopy of needles to breathe in one of nature’s most refreshing aromas.:
